Is the Search Indexing service turned off? I don’t think that search bar actually searches the file system. I think it only searches the Search Index.

Oh I’m gonna find this! My hate for Windows Search knows no bounds. It’s SO useless, I more often than not just open a cmd prompt from Explorer and do a dir /s.

openshell gives you a windows 7 like start menu on 10 but also has neat features like a working search.
